Celtic played in a bounce game this morning against St Gallen’s under 21 side in what was a hastily put together fixture. It enabled Neil Lennon to give a lot of his squad 80 minutes of football and allow him to play a more senior squad in the friendly against the first team.
Celtic TV did not show the bounce game between a Celtic select and the young St Gallen side but they did record the game from the stands.
Celtic won 9-1 on Tuesday morning with Leigh Griffiths getting four of those goals.
The Celtic TV social media account posted the pick of the bunch as Leigh spotted the young keeper off his line.

Neil Lennon could be set to debut Chris Jullien and Luca Connell later this evening when the Celtic manager plays a side who could start the Champions League tie with Sarajevo next week. Leigh has certainly given his manager food for thought for that tie!
